Dancing Partners: Nike's Representation Dips Among Women's NCAA Tournament Teams

Nike and its affiliated brands sponsor 37 of the 64 teams in some capacity in the NCAA women’s basketball tournament, down 12 from last year's tourney, according to THE DAILY's annual breakdown of the shoe and apparel brands worn in the tourney. Eighteen teams wear adidas shoes, up 10 from last year. Under Armour, which sponsored seven teams in the tourney a year ago, has nine this year. Russell Athletic supplies the jerseys for two schools, down from three last year. Schools in the chart below are listed by region in their seed order. The first round of the women's tournament begins Friday (THE DAILY).

SBJ I Factor: Gloria Nevarez

SBJ I Factor features an interview with Mountain West Conference Commissioner Gloria Nevarez. The second-ever MWC commissioner chats with SBJ’s Ross Nethery about her climb through the collegiate ranks. Nevarez is a member of SBJ’s Game Changers Class of 2019. Nevarez has had stints at the conference level in the Pac-12, West Coast Conference, and Mountain West Conference as well as at the college level at Oklahoma, Cal, and San Jose State. She shares stories of that journey as well as how being a former student-athlete guides her decision-making today. SBJ I Factor is a monthly podcast offering interviews with sports executives who have been recipients of one of the magazine’s awards.
